Does CRS charge for services?

Yes, we are a full-service provider specializing in large-scale commercial property clean-outs and decommissioning. We handle labor, vendors, equipment, and waste management, ensuring efficient transportation of your furniture, fixtures, and equipment (FF&E) for donation, recycling, or disposal. All related expenses are included in our project management fee.


Is there a required minimum size for projects?

Our minimum project size is 10,000 square feet. We excel in large-scale cleanouts, concentrating on thoroughly clearing commercial properties, which includes the removal of furniture, fixtures, and equipment during relocations, transitions, or closures, while overseeing all aspects of disassembly, removal, and disposal.


Does CRS purchase or sell my FF&E?

CRS does not acquire furniture, fixtures, and equipment but may assist with reselling on a case-by-case basis. Factors include demand, timelines, condition, and potential for direct sale. We connect with auction houses, resellers, and online marketplaces. While sales aren't guaranteed, we aim to donate and recycle when possible.

What is the required notice to initiate a project?

We recommend giving two weeks' notice before a commercial property clean-out decommissioning project, though we understand that unexpected situations can arise. Depending on the project's size and our team's availability, we can manage urgent requests. Our commitment to customer satisfaction drives us to seek every possible solution for success.


How long will my project take?

Each project has distinct characteristics. The timeline is influenced by factors such as square footage, access points, working hours, number of components, equipment placement, and on-site accommodation. While unforeseen circumstances may occur, we address each challenge directly to ensure timely completion.
